Autruche Posted September 5, 2010 Author Report Share Posted September 5, 2010 Alright, some pics? why not? Started working on the port faces. This is how not to use a table saw, unless you know what you're doing. Finishing the port face. Had to trim the ports down. I had to crunch the numbers to make sure everything was perfect, the box came out to 6.5 cubic feet, after all displacements. 36 hz port is 96 square inches, and 32 hz port is 80 square inches.
